πŸ“˜Β Waste Management Law – Plastic, Solid, E-Waste, Biomedical with Guidelines | Rajan Nijhawan | ILBCO INDIA

Waste Management Law – Plastic, Solid, E-Waste, Biomedical with Guidelines by Rajan Nijhawan, published by ILBCO INDIA, is a comprehensive legal and regulatory reference covering major areas of waste management law in India, including Plastic Waste, Solid Waste, E-Waste and Biomedical Waste, along with relevant guidelines.

The book is useful for understanding the regulatory framework relating to waste generation, segregation, collection, storage, transportation, processing, recycling, treatment, disposal, environmental compliance and responsibilities of waste generators and other stakeholders.

It can be particularly useful for environmental law professionals, compliance officers, industries, waste management companies, municipalities, healthcare establishments, manufacturers, recyclers, legal professionals, consultants and students studying environmental and regulatory law.
